George Neal vs. Bill Smith — Career Comparison
Looking at the career totals, George Neal and Bill Smith are closely matched on the surface stats. Bill Smith posted stronger numbers in slugging (.174 vs .140) and batting average (.174 vs .120). George Neal had the advantage in on-base percentage (.200 vs .174). By the career numbers, Bill Smith had the stronger overall case — though those totals don't account for the eras and run environments each player worked in.
